Market Overview:
The global cancer/tumor profiling market size reached US$ 10.4 Billion in 2022. Looking forward, IMARC Group expects the market to reach US$ 18.4 Billion by 2028, exhibiting a growth rate (CAGR) of 9.8% during 2023-2028.
Cancer/tumor profiling, also known as biomarker testing, refers to a laboratory test or procedure used to identify specific proteins, genes or gene mutations (changes) and other biomarkers in a tumor tissue sample. It assists oncologists in determining if the pathways of a patient’s tumor match up with the available targeted therapies. It also aids in routine diagnostics, therapeutic decision-making, and developing personalized treatment plans and therapies for individuals based on the severity of their ailment and genomic build-up. Cancer/tumor profiling also finds extensive applications in personalized medicine, research, the discovery of biomarkers, and the development of screening and diagnostic techniques.

Cancer/Tumor Profiling Market Trends:
Cancer/tumor profiling is widely used in oncology research and discovery of biomarkers during the process of drug design, discovery and development. As a result, the widespread prevalence of cancer across the globe represents the primary factor driving the market growth. Besides this, the growing focus on biomarkers for diagnosis and tumor profiling and the shifting preferences toward personalized medicine among the masses are augmenting the product demand. Additionally, there has been a significant rise in government funding and support for cancer research for the development of advanced techniques to reduce the time taken for the detection and identification of tumors. Along with this, the recent advancements in molecular biology techniques, such as next-generation sequencing (NGS), are accelerating the adoption of cancer/tumor profiling. Furthermore, the increasing investments by pharmaceutical and biotechnology companies in research and development (R&D) activities for the launch of novel therapies and new drug designing techniques are propelling the market growth. Other factors, including the rising number of clinical trials, growing adoption of immunoassay techniques, favorable reimbursement policies, improving healthcare infrastructure, and technological advancements, are also creating a positive outlook for the market.
